【mysql-当事件循环正在等待数据库操作时,如何处理对nodejs服务器的传入请求】教程文章相关的互联网学习教程文章

Node.js连接mysql数据库方法

1.下载mysql数据库连接地址:https://dev.mysql.com/downloads/mysql/2.在目录中下载mysql包命令:npm install mysql3.mysql操作代码1 2 3 4 5 6 7 8 9 10 11 12 13 14var?mysql?=?require('mysql'); var?connection?=?mysql.createConnection({ ??host?????:?'主机名', ??user?????:?'用户名', ??password?:?'密码', ??database?:?'库名称', ??port?????:?'端口号' }); connection.connect(); connection.query('select?*?from?表名...

nodejs MongoDB 数据库创建删除、表( 集合)(10)

目录一、 数据库使用............................................................................................................ 1二、 创建数据库............................................................................................................ 2三、 插入(增加)数据................................................................................................. 3四、 查找数据................

javascript-Node.js节点-mysql模块未连接到数据库【代码】

我正在运行此脚本:var mysql = require('mysql');var connection = mysql.createConnection("mysql://localhost/");connection.connect(); console.log(connection)但是出现错误…{ config: { host: 'localhost',port: 3306,socketPath: undefined,user: undefined,password: undefined,database: '',insecureAuth: false,supportBigNumbers: false,debug: undefined,timezone: 'local',flags: '',queryFormat: undefined,po...

nodeJS从入门到进阶三(MongoDB数据库)

一、MongoDB数据库 1、概念 数据库(DataBase)是一个按照数据结构进行数据的组织,管理,存放数据的仓库。 2、关系型数据库 按照关系模型存储的数据库,数据与数据之间的关系非常密切,可以实现跨数据表查询数据,占用更少的硬盘实现更多的数据存储 T-SQL标准的结构化查询语言,是关系型数据库的通用查询语言 常见的关系型数据库:Mysql sql-server access sqlite..... 结构:一台服务器==》数据库==》数据表==》数据行 3、非关系...

nodejs---sqlite数据库API使用及增删查改【图】

SQLite:小巧轻型的文件数据库,无需安装,无需管理配置,无服务器,占用资源非常的低,操作简单,使用方便。 全局安装【npm install sqlite3 -g】 API使用介绍:API用法功能Databasenew sqlite3.Database(filename,[mode],[callback])返回数据库对象并且自动打开和连接数据库。它没有独立打开数据库的方法。verbosesqlite3.verbose()集成数据库的执行模式,以便于调试,它没有重置的方法。close Database#close([callback])关闭和...

Node.js 连接 MongoDB数据库

安装指令:npm install mongodb var mongodb = require("mongodb");// console.log(mongodb); var MongoClient = mongodb.MongoClient; var CONN_DB_STR = "mongodb://localhost:27017/wh1807"; MongoClient.connect(CONN_DB_STR,(err,db)=>{ if(err) throw err; console.log("数据库链接成功..."); console.log(db);var movie = db.collection("movie"); movie.find({},{title:1,year:1,genres:1,_id:0}).toArray((er...

Node.js 连接 MySQL数据库

安装指令:npm install mysql var mysql = require("mysql");console.log(mysql); // 创建链接对象 var conn = mysql.createConnection({ host:localhost, port:3306, user:"root", password:root, database:"wh1807"}) // 链接数据库 conn.connect((err)=>{ if(err) throw err; console.log("数据库链接成功!")}); var insertSql = "insert into user1807 (username,password) values (?,?)";var insertPar...

mysql – 无法从node.js服务器连接到localhost数据库【代码】

尝试连接到我的localhost数据库时遇到了很多麻烦.我尝试过使用mysql和mysql-simple节点模块,但在这两种情况下我都无法连接它. 这是我在’mysql’模块中使用的内容:var mysql = require('mysql'); var connection = mysql.createConnection({host : 'localhost',port : '8000',user : 'uber',password : 'pass', });connection.connect(function(err) {if (err) throw err;console.log('Connection Successful'); });c...

node.js爬虫入门 导出json文件并导入数据库(二)【代码】【图】

离上个月入门一半个多月了,如今数据库已配,现在就是加数据,服务器配置 实际项目中还是会遇到坑,比如今天的乱码,偏老的网站gbk2312;有想把线上地址图片截取图片名,放在自己的项目路径中;还有有些网站有反扒。//导入依赖包 const fs = require("fs");const superagent = require("superagent"); const cheerio = require("cheerio"); const mongoose = require('mongoose'); var charset = require("superagent-charset") ch...

javascript – NodeJS Express Mongoose(MongoDB)数据库插入错误【代码】

当我使用NodeJS / Express / Mongoose执行以下代码时,mongodb日志中出现错误“Sun Jun 12 15:27:12 SyntaxError:missing; before statement(shell):1”.我没有从函数返回错误.任何指导都将非常感谢.// Launch express and server var express = require('express'); var app = express.createServer();//connect to DB var mongoose = require('mongoose'); var db = mongoose.connect('mongodb://127.0.0.1/napkin_0.1');// Def...

php – 使用NodeJS使用数据库进行实时实时更新视图

我一直在玩Nodejs,现在想知道我是否可以创建一个视图/页面的实时更新,如tutorial here所示 上面的示例将适用于网站上的所有用户,我想要的是将我的更新定位到某些用户. 我是否创建了一个存储所有客户端套接字的阵列,在用户登录时会创建一个套接字. 另一件事我如何更新网页或视图如果数据库中的某些内容已更新我是否每秒轮询一次服务器? 我使用MySQL有数据库,我应该使用Redis吗? 编辑:还有一个问题我想知道nodejs如何检查数据库字...

如何使用JavaScript和Node.js将捕获的图像存储到MySQL数据库中【代码】

我正在使用canvas捕获图像,我想使用Javascript将捕获的图像存储在MySQL数据库中. 这是我的代码:<html> <head><meta charset="utf-8"><meta name="viewport" content="width=device-width, maximum-scale=1.0"><style>body {width: 100%;}canvas {display: none;}</style><title>Instant Camera - Remote</title><script>var video, canvas, msg;var load = function () {video = document.getElementById('video');canvas = doc...

NodeJS MySQL Socket.IO:更新数据库【代码】

我目前正在寻找有关NodeJS和MySQL数据库推送通知的解决方案. 我想将NodeJS与Socket.IO结合起来提供推送通知,但问题是我不知道如何让我的服务器检查我的数据库是否有更新. 我已经有一个完美的“轮询”方法,但它有点乱,而且在服务器调用和响应方面并没有真正优化. 因此,我的想法是,当用户A在我的数据库中插入某些内容时,跟随他的所有客户端都会通过推送(推送,而非轮询)得到通知. 这就是我目前为我的server.js所拥有的:var app ...

NodeJS开发博客(二) 接入数据库【图】

1. mysql 数据库下载网址:https://dev.mysql.com/downloads/mysql/ 账号是 root 密码是 a1************ 网站账号是邮箱,密码是 Aa1******** 2 mysql workbench。操作mysql的客户端,可视化操作。 下载地址是 https://dev.mysql.com/downloads/workbench alert table是继续编辑表; drop table是删除表

NodeJS连接mysql数据库【代码】

1,下载cnpm install mysql2,引入并配置修改数据库用户名密码及数据库名var mysql = require(mysql); var connection = mysql.createConnection({host : localhost,user : root,password : 123456,database : test });connection.connect();connection.query(SELECT 1 + 1 AS solution, function (error, results, fields) {if (error) throw error;console.log(The solution is: , results[0].solution); });3,如果...